Senior Software Engineer, Integrations
Censys is on a mission to provide comprehensive Internet intelligence and actionable threat insights. They are seeking a Senior Integrations Software Engineer to build and maintain integrations between the Censys platform and various third-party security systems, enhancing visibility and threat response capabilities for organizations and governments.

Responsibilities
Design, implement and maintain robust integrations between Censys Platform and third-party SOAR, SIEM, TIPs solutions
Develop and operate scalable, high-availability API connectors
Maintain and improve existing Censys open source APIs
Write and maintain internal pipelines and IaC to manage the deployment of new and existing Censys-hosted integrations and services
Design automated solutions for building, testing, monitoring, and deploying applications in a continuous integration environment
Maintain a strong customer focus, prioritizing customer feature requests and helping define the integrations roadmap
Stay current on emerging SOAR, SIEM, and TIP technologies to guide integration strategy
